December 2018 by James B.
Tonight my family dined at the Figure Eight Island Yacht Club. I will start my review by saying that it is a very beautiful setting. Our party consisted of nine people. The salads and bread at the beginning of our meal where nice and had nice flavor. The menu has two categories one has club favorites which they serve all the time and the other side had "featured" items. Thinking that the "featured" items might have a bit more going for it I ordered from that. Three of us ordered the Herb Roasted Chicken on the "featured" section. It was a TOTAL flop! The chicken consisted of two very small boneless pieces that where so over cooked and dry that it resembled the over cooked turkey on National Lampoon's Christmas Vacation! It was dry and tough! Three of the group ordered the Shrimp and Grits. The flavor was fare and had four small shrimp on the plate. It was a mere snack at best! I felt extremely embarrassed for my wife's parents entertaining guests from out of town. The prices are outrageous considering the quality and quantity of what they consider presentable food! I have had better meals at K&W Cafeteria for a fraction of the cost when I was in college years ago!!! If in north Wilmington you would be much better off going to Cape Fear Seafood Company on Market Street. Now I understand why our party was one out of a total of three in the entire dining room at 7:00pm on a Saturday night.

November 2018 by Katie Salamandra
I could go on forever about how amazing Jennifer and her entire staff are. My husband and I are from Texas and we planned to get married in September at a different venue when hurricane florence had other plans for us as our venue suffered a lot of damage. A week away from the wedding day, my Aunt quickly contacted F8 yacht club, where there happened to be an opening for a wedding on that same Saturday, and Jennifer and her team worked SO incredibly hard to get the yacht club (which also, as you could imagine, suffered quite a bit of damage itself) back in shape. They amount of work and extra hours they put in did not go unnoticed. It was the most BEAUTIFUL wedding—better than I ever could have imagined, and honestly, probably even more beautiful than our original venue would've been. Jennifer and her staff deserve not 5 stars, but 10 stars. Thank you all for making my wedding day so unforgettable!
